An established and growing manufacturer of construction products is seeking an experienced Works Manager to lead its production operation in Colchester. This is a hands-on management role, ideal for someone with experience in heavy manufacturing, construction materials, concrete, aggregates, quarrying, precast, asphalt, recycling or other industrial production environments.
You will be responsible for managing a team of around 15 production staff, ensuring efficient manufacturing, maintaining quality standards and driving continuous improvement across the site.
Duties
Lead and manage a team of 15 production operatives
Oversee day-to-day manufacturing and production activities
Plan and coordinate daily, weekly and monthly production schedules
Drive productivity improvements and reduce waste
Monitor quality, output and production performance
Implement and maintain company procedures and policies
Train, coach and develop production staff
Ensure Health & Safety and environmental standards are met
Investigate and resolve production issues
Ensure products are prepared correctly for dispatch
Oversee vehicle loading and on-time deliveries Requirements
Previous experience as a Works Manager, Production Manager, Manufacturing Manager, Factory Manager or Operations Manager
Background within heavy manufacturing or construction product manufacturing
Proven people management and leadership experience
Strong understanding of production planning and continuous improvement
Health & Safety knowledge (IOSH qualification desirable)
Excellent communication and organisational skills
Hands-on approach with the ability to lead by exampleBenefits
